It is important to understand that anybody you speak to about Medicare insurance plans is almost always an insurance agent. That’s the law. But there are important differences. And that’s why we provide the following tips for finding someone who is working for your benefit.

Tips: How To Find One Terrific Medicare Advisor

MEDICARE IS NATIONAL; BUT MEDICARE PLANS ARE LOCAL. It’s true. Plans available to you are generally based on the County you live in. Television ads urging you to call a toll-free number generally will direct your call to a Call Center. The agent you’ll speak with may not be familiar with everything available in your immediate area.

AGENTS HAVE INCENTIVE TO SELL YOU CERTAIN PLANS. Heavens no you say. Unfortunately it’s true. No one will ever admit it. But it’s true. An agent selling you a Medicare Advantage plan can earn much more than they can selling you a Medicare Supplement plan. Is the agent being urged to sell certain plans? Are there incentives (free trips or other rewards)? Could be. You need to know that.

SOME AGENTS ONLY OFFER ONE PLAN. It may be the best plan for you. Or, it may be the only one they are able to discuss. If that’s the case, guess which one they’ll try to convince you is the best.

NO AGENT EVER OFFERS ALL AVAILABLE OPTIONS. Well, someone, somewhere might. But, in many areas a senior will have between 20 and 40 different Medicare Advantage (MA) plans available. And, another 20 different Medigap insurers offering Medicare Supplement. The better independent Medicare brokers will be appointed with multiple companies. But, probably not all of them.

Next, pick 1, 2 or even 3 different agents. Here’s why we recommend more than one.

ONE SOLUTION OR MULTIPLE OPTIONS: Selling Medicare is complex. And, the government adds a whole host of requirements designed to protect you. That’s good. But, as a result, some insurance agents will only sell Medicare Supplement (Medigap). Others will only sell Medicare Advantage (MA plans). Today many will sell both. It’s important for you to know this information. Hint; many agents listed on the Association’s directory will specify in their description.

WHICH COMPANIES ARE THEY APPOINTED WITH? There are many companies offering Medicare plans. Some are big, like UnitedHealthcare and CVS (Aetna). Others may only be available in one state, like Blue Shield of California. And, then there are new companies who have just started offering plans. For example, Aflac and Allstate started offering Medigap recently. It’s really rare that any agent will be selling all plans. So, a good quuestion to ask is which ones they are appointed with. And, which one(s) they sold the most of last year.

AND EXPERIENCE MATTERS: Picking the best Medicare plan is complex. Incredibly complicated. And making the wrong decision can be fixed; but not always. Besides you don’t want the wrong plan. So picking someone with experience can be a benefit. We love new agents. Many of thjem will work incredibly hard for you. That’s good. But again, it’s something to ask.

Who Are The Biggest Medicare Advantage Companies?

We recently posted the largest Medicare Advantage plans in our Medicare Information Center. As of 2022, here are the top-10.

  1. UnitedHealthcare
  2. Humana
  3. CVS (Aetna)
  4. Elevance Health (formerly Anthem)
  5. Kaiser
  6. Centene
  7. Blue Cross Blue Shield of Michigan
  8. Cigna Health
  9. Highmark Health
  10. Guidewell (holding company for Florida Blue)

But, keep in mind that there are literally hundreds of different plans available. One of the big ones may be your best option. Or, it might not be your best choice.

Is AARP Medicare Plan The Best Choice?

AARP does not directly offer Medicare insurance. They have a reciprocal arrangement with UnitedHealthcare. The various plans are offered by UnitedHealthcare (UHC). They pay AARP.

According to a story in the Sun Sentinel Jul 14, 2020 — AARP receives a 4.95% fee for each plan sold and has received over $4 billion to date. The partnership will continue through at least 2025.

AARP Medicare Advantage plans are insured by UnitedHealthcare — the largest Medicare Advantage provider in the country. The plans definitely offer several benefits that aren’t available in Original Medicare. This includes some coverage for preventive dental care, vision care and hearing exams.

ARP Medicare Advantage plans are available in 48 states and Washington, D.C. As of Fall 2022, more than 4 million people are enrolled in AARP plans.  UnitedHealthcare is the largest health insurer in the country by market share. It is the largest among for-profit health plans. More than 8.2 million Medicare beneficiaries are enrolled in a UnitedHealthcare Medicare Advantage plan.
